How to Pick the Right LPN College near Oneida Tennessee

Oneida TN LPN pediatric nurse holding infantThere are essentially two scholastic credentials available that provide instruction to become an LPN near Oneida TN. The one that can be concluded in the shortest time period, typically about twelve months, is the certificate or diploma program. The second choice is to obtain a Practical Nursing Associate Degree. These LPN programs are broader in nature than the diploma alternative and commonly require 2 years to finish. The benefit of Associate Degrees, along with supplying a higher credential and more extensive training, are that they furnish more transferable credit toward a Bachelor’s Degree in nursing. No matter the type of credential you seek, it should be state approved and accredited by the National League for Nursing Accrediting Commission (NLNAC) or any other national accrediting organization. The NLNAC warrants that the syllabus adequately prepares students to become Practical Nurses, and that most graduates pass the 50 state required NCLEX-PN licensing exam.

What is an LPN?

Oneida TN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N)Licensed Practical Nurses have a number of duties that they complete in the Oneida TN health care facilities where they practice. As their titles indicate, they are mandated to be licensed in all states, including Tennessee. While they may be accountable for monitoring Certified Nursing Assistants (CNA), they themselves usually work under the direction of either an RN or a doctor. The medical care facilities where they work are numerous and assorted, including hospitals, medical clinics, schools, and long-term care facilities. Anyplace that you can find patients requiring medical attention is their domain. Each state not only regulates their licensing, but also what work activities an LPN can and can’t perform. So based on the state, their everyday job functions may include:

  • Taking vital signs
  • Providing medicines
  • Setting up IV drips
  • Overseeing patients
  • Taking blood or urine samples
  • Maintaining patient records
  • Helping doctors or RNs with procedures

Along with their job functions being mandated by each state, the healthcare facilities or other Oneida TN healthcare providers where LPNs work can additionally limit their job duties within those parameters. Additionally, they can practice in different specialties of nursing, such as long-term care, critical care, oncology and cardiology.

Online LPN Programs

female student attending LPN school online in Oneida TNEnrolling in LPN programs online is becoming a more favored way to receive instruction and attain a nursing certificate or degree in Oneida TN. Certain schools will require attending on campus for part of the training, and nearly all programs call for a certain number of clinical rotation hours conducted in a local healthcare facility. But since the balance of the training can be accessed online, this alternative may be a more convenient approach to finding the free time to attend college for many students. Pertaining to tuition, some online degree programs are cheaper than other on campus alternatives. Even supplementary expenses such as for commuting and study materials may be minimized, helping to make education more economical. And a large number of online programs are accredited by U.S. Department of Education recognized organizations. And so if your work and household obligations have left you with little time to pursue your academic goals, it could be that an online LPN school will make it more convenient to fit a degree into your hectic schedule.

LPN Salary

According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for Licensed Practical Nurses (LPN) was $45,030 in May 2017. The median wage is the wage at which half the workers in an occupation earned more than that amount and half earned less. The lowest 10 percent earned less than $32,970, and the highest 10 percent earned more than $61,030. Most licensed practical nurses near Oneida TN work full time, although about 1 in 5 worked part time in 2016. Many work nights, weekends, and holidays, because medical care takes place at all hours. They may be required to work shifts of longer than 8 hours. Employment of LPNs is projected to grow 12 percent from 2016 to 2026.  Job prospects should be favorable for LPNs who are willing to work in rural and medically under served areas.

Questions to Ask LPN Schools

Questions to ask Oneida TN LPN programsOnce you have decided on obtaining your LPN certificate, and if you will attend classes on campus or on the internet, you can use the following guidelines to start narrowing down your options. As you undoubtedly realize, there are many nursing schools and colleges near Oneida TN as well as within Tennessee and throughout the United States. So it is essential to decrease the number of schools to choose from so that you will have a workable list. As we already discussed, the site of the school along with the price of tuition are undoubtedly going to be the initial two things that you will look at. But as we also stressed, they should not be your sole qualifiers. So prior to making your final choice, use the following questions to evaluate how your selection compares to the other schools.

  • Accreditation. It’s a good idea to make sure that the certificate program in addition to the school are accredited by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ged accrediting agency. Aside from helping confirm that you receive an excellent education, it may assist in acquiring financial aid or student loans, which are frequently not offered for non-accredited schools near Oneida TN.
  • Licensing Preparation. Licensing criteria for LPNs differ from state to state. In all states, a passing score is needed on the National Council Licensure Examination (NCLEX-PN) in addition to graduation from an accredited school. Certain states require a specific number of clinical hours be completed, as well as the passing of additional tests. It’s imperative that the school you are attending not only provides an outstanding education, but also readies you to meet the minimum licensing standards for Tennessee or the state where you will be working.
  • Reputation. Look at internet rating companies to see what the assessments are for each of the LPN schools you are looking into. Ask the accrediting organizations for their reviews too. In addition, get in touch with the Tennessee school licensing authority to find out if there are any complaints or compliance issues. Finally, you can contact some nearby Oneida TN healthcare organizations you’re interested in working for after graduation and ask what their opinions are of the schools as well.
  • Graduation and Job Placement Rates. Find out from the LPN programs you are looking at what their graduation rates are as well as how long on average it takes students to complete their programs. A low graduation rate may be an indication that students were displeased with the program and dropped out. It’s also essential that the schools have high job placement rates. A high rate will not only confirm that the school has a superb reputation within the Oneida TN medical community, but that it also has the network of relationships to help students obtain a position.
  • Internship Programs. The most effective way to get experience as a Licensed Practical Nurse is to work in a clinical setting. Virtually all nursing degree programs require a specified number of clinical hours be completed. Various states have minimum clinical hour prerequisites for licensing also. Find out if the schools have associations with local Oneida TN community hospitals, clinics or labs and assist with the placement of students in internships.

Oneida, Tennessee

Oneida is known for its proximity to the Big South Fork National River and Recreation Area. The town is named for Oneida, New York, the home of several railroad executives who helped develop the town in the late 19th century.[7]

As of the census[5] of 2000, there were 3,615 people, 1,588 households, and 986 families residing in the town. The population density was 355.4 people per square mile (137.2/km²). There were 1,715 housing units at an average density of 168.6 per square mile (65.1/km²). The racial makeup of the town was 98.34% White, 0.03% African American, 0.14% Native American, 0.39% Asian, 0.19% from other races, and 0.91%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 0.30% of the population.

There were 1,588 households out of which 30.8%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 43.3% were married couples living together, 15.4% had a female householder with no husband present, and 37.9% were non-families. 35.5% of all households were made up of individuals and 14.5%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.24 and the average family size was 2.91.
